Faraz Farooqui

Pakistani actor From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ia

Remove ads

Faraz Farooqui is a Pakistani actor and model. He is known for his roles in Khalish, Dil-e-Bereham, Meri Ladli, Qismat Ka Likha, Ishq Hai, Bharosa Pyar Tera and Malaal-e-Yaar.[1]

Early life

Faraz took part in reality dance competition called Nachle that was judged by Faysal Quraishi, Reshma and Noor. Then his brother Hammad was selected but he didn't pass and then he worked as an educationist.[2]

Career

In 2012 he made his debut as an actor in drama Meri Ladli.[3] He appeared in dramas Mere Baba Ki Ounchi Haveli, Besharam, Malkin and Lamhay. Then he appeared in dramas Kabhi Band Kabhi Baja, Khalish, Qismat Ka Likha, Dil-e-Bereham and Malaal-e-Yaar.[4] Since then he appeared in dramas Bharosa Pyar Tera, Sotan, Ishq Hai, Oye Motti Season 2, Dil-e-Veeran and Samjhota.[5] In 2024, he had a brief role of a pehalwan in sports-drama Akhara. The News International described his performance as a "decent job".[6]

Personal life

Faraz married Shiza Khan in 2016. The couple has a son and daughter.[7][8] His older twin brother Hammad is also an actor.[9]
